Why do wrestlers wear boots?

Wrestling shoes are active wear used in competition and practice for the sport of wrestling. Generally light and flexible, they try to mimic the bare foot , while providing slightly more traction and ankle support and less chance of contracting a disease or hurting the opponent with exposed toe nails.

Why do wrestlers wear tight suits?

The uniform is tight-fitting so as not to get grasped accidentally by one’s opponent , and allows the referee to see each wrestler’s body clearly when awarding points or a pin.

Do wrestlers wear a cup?

Combat Protection

Wrestling is not only a contact sport — it’s a combat sport. ... For men, a groin cup is a common addition to the singlet uniform — though since their advent in the early 2000s, many wrestlers prefer to simply wear compression shorts.

When did wrestlers start wearing clothes?

During the late 1930s and early 1940s , some athletes began to switch up their wrestling gear. Wrestlers at a few colleges, including Oklahoma State and Kent State University in Ohio, started wearing tight-fitting trunks that were made of wool. And that’s it.

What is stiff wrestling?

Stiff is a term for when a wrestler puts excessive force into his attacks or maneuvers on his opponent, deliberately or accidentally .

Who is the greatest American heavyweight Olympic wrestler?

Baumgartner is among the best American wrestlers of all time. His five international titles places him second behind only John Smith, he shares this second-place position with Jordan Burroughs. Between 1983 and 1996, Baumgartner won 13 World or Olympic medals.

Do wrestlers wear mouthguards?

Mouthguards. Mouthguards are a low-cost way to protect the teeth, lips, cheeks, and tongue. In many school districts, mouthguards are required for wrestlers who have braces .
